Macarthur vs Western Sydney Wanderers prediction

Western Sydney Wanderers suffered more agony this past weekend as they led by two goals to one away at Central Coast Mariners heading into the final 15 minutes, only to wind up losing 3-2. The Wanderers have now lost exactly half their A-League games this season and to surrender a lead in a such a fashion to the Mariners will have proven another psychological body blow.

Macarthur haven’t been in the best of form themselves lately, not winning any of their last three games. But this is an ideal fixture for them to put that right. Western Sydney Wanderers rarely succeed on the road with just one victory away from home all season. Macarthur boast a stronger squad and should do enough to claim three points.
